Definitions
American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ition
- n. The act, process, or practice of experimenting.
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
- n. The act or practice of making experiments; the process of experimenting.
Wiktionary
- n. The act of experimenting; practice by experiment.
- n. sciences A set of actions and observations, performed to verify or falsify a hypothesis or to research a causal relationship between phenomena.
GNU Webster's 1913
- n. The act of experimenting; practice by experiment.
WordNet 3.0
- n. the act of conducting a controlled test or investigation
- n. the testing of an idea
Etymologies
- From Latin ex- + -periri (akin to periculum), attempt (Wiktionary)
